H-3 has entered the Anchorage music scene with a vibrant and new type of sound unique to the islands of Hawaii.

Anchorage deserves "island music". Many equate Hawaiian music to "Don Ho" and elevator type "steel guitar" music, but these island boys play the new and contemporary style which is island reggae, island contemporary Hawaiian, blues, and yes..... traditional Hawaiian. I respect these guys for keeping their island roots a part of their music reportoire.

I'm a local deejay for KNBA 90.3 FM Island Style and I play a wide range of Hawaiian/Polynesian music and I listen to many promos from new artists from Hawaii. Island contemporary and reggae are my favorites. H-3 plays a variety of island music and reggae (previously recorded and originals)..... Let me tell you, H-3 is comparable to these bands, and for the most part, superior.
